This is a description of a homeopathic medicine called "Indica," made from Indian Nettle. The medicine is meant to relieve dry cough and comes in the form of pellets. The active ingredients are listed as HPUS, with instructions to take 3-4 pellets dissolved in the mouth 3 times a day until symptoms are relieved or as directed by a health professional. The product should be stored at room temperature and contains lactose and sucrose as inactive ingredients. The warning advises that the product should not be used if the pellet-dispenser seal is broken and to stop use and ask a doctor if symptoms persist for more than 3 days or worsen. If pregnant or breastfeeding, a health professional should be consulted before use. The letters 'HPUS' indicate that the component in this product is officially monographed in the Homeopathic Pharmacopoeia of the United States.*
